Types of Home Espresso Machines
Home espresso machines can be categorized into numerous classifications based upon their mechanisms and user-friendliness. Each type has its distinct features, pros, and cons.
Type | Description | Pros | Cons |
---|---|---|---|
Manual Espresso Machines | Requires the user to by hand manage the developing process, including methods like pulling a lever to develop pressure. | - Complete control over developing procedure - Compact design | - Requires ability and practice - Time-consuming |
Semi-Automatic Machines | Machine automates water circulation and pressure, but the user still manages the dosing and duration of the brewing process. | - Balance of automation and control - Versatile | - Learning curve for refining techniques |
Fully Automatic Machines | Automates the entire brewing procedure, from grinding to developing, often with programmable settings for personalized drinks. | - Extremely easy to use - Quick and hassle-free | - Less control over the brewing process - Higher rate point |
Pill or Pod Machines | Utilizes pre-packaged espresso capsules or pods to create coffee quickly and quickly. | - Extremely easy to use - Minimal clean-up | - Limited flavor variety - More expensive per cup than ground coffee |
Super-Automatic Machines | Integrates functions of fully automatic machines with built-in grinders, enabling users to brew entire bean espresso and milk-based beverages with one touch. | - All-in-one benefit - Ideal for milk-based beverages | - Often the most pricey - Can be bulky |
Features to Consider
When selecting a home espresso machine, potential purchasers ought to think about the following functions to ensure they choose a machine that meets their requirements:
Grinder Type:
- Built-in mills can supply fresher premises however may require more upkeep.
- Different grinders permit more customization of grind size.
Pressure:
- Look for machines that produce a minimum of 9 bars of pressure, which is optimal for brewing espresso.
Water Temperature Control:
- Machines with adjustable temperature level settings enable for much better extraction of flavor from beans.
Milk Frothing Options:
- Consider whether you desire a manual steam wand for frothing or an automatic milk frother for benefit.
Reduce of Cleaning:
- Machines with detachable parts and self-cleaning functions significantly lower cleanup time.
Size and Design:
- Ensure the machine fits comfortably in your kitchen and lines up with your aesthetic preferences.
Budget:
- Set a budget before starting your search, as rates can vary considerably from affordable designs to high-end machines.
Benefits of Home Espresso Machines
Owning a home espresso machine uses numerous benefits:
- Cost-Effective: Over time, brewing espresso at home can save coffee lovers cash compared to frequent coffee shop gos to.
- Modification: Users can experiment with various beans, grind sizes, and brewing techniques to discover their perfect cup.
- Convenience: The capability to brew espresso at any time eliminates the need to go out to a coffee shop, particularly helpful during late nights or early mornings.
- Quality assurance: With a home machine, people have total control over the quality of active ingredients and brewing procedures.
Disadvantages of Home Espresso Machines
However, there are some downsides to think about:
- Initial Investment: High-quality espresso machines can be pricey, requiring a considerable in advance investment.
- Learning Curve: Mastering the art of espresso brewing can take some time and practice, which might be frightening for beginners.
- Maintenance: Like any device, espresso machines need routine cleaning and upkeep to ensure optimal performance.
